Why These Are the Top Pest Control Contractors in Dow City

** The pest control market for Dow City, Iowa, is characterized by a reliance on reputable regional and family-owned businesses from neighboring population centers like Denison, Harlan, and Earling. There is no significant "in-city" competition, which means the service quality is high as providers compete on a regional basis based on reputation, reliability, and range of services. The competition level is moderate, with a handful of established players dominating the market. These companies have built trust over decades and through word-of-mouth in the tight-knit rural communities. Typical pests of concern include mice and other rodents, ants, spiders, and occasional issues with termites or wildlife like raccoons and squirrels. **Typical Pricing:** For standard residential preventative plans, initial setup can range from **$150 - $300**, with quarterly follow-up visits costing **$50 - $100 per service**. One-time services for specific issues (e.g., rodent removal, ant treatment) generally start at **$250 - $500**. More intensive treatments like termite tenting or bed bug heat treatments are significantly more expensive, often ranging from **$1,200 to $2,500+**, depending on the size of the home and severity of the infestation. Most companies offer free inspections and quotes.

Frequently Asked Questions About Pest Control in Dow City

Get answers to common questions about pest control services in Dow City, Iowa.

1What are the most common pest problems for homeowners in Dow City, and when should I be most vigilant?

In Dow City, the most prevalent pests include mice and voles seeking warmth in fall/winter, ants (especially carpenter and pavement ants) in spring/summer, and occasional issues with wasps, boxelder bugs, and spiders. Due to Iowa's distinct seasons, vigilance is key: rodent-proof your home before late fall, watch for ant trails after spring rains, and manage standing water in summer to deter mosquitoes.

2How much should I expect to pay for professional pest control services in the Dow City area?

Costs vary based on pest type and property size. For a standard one-time treatment (e.g., for ants), homeowners might pay $100-$300. Ongoing quarterly services for general pest prevention typically range from $40-$70 per visit. Rodent exclusion or termite treatments are more specialized and costly. Always get itemized estimates from local providers, as Iowa's rural landscape can sometimes influence travel fees.

3Are there any local Iowa or Crawford County regulations I should know about regarding pest control treatments?

Yes, all commercial pest control applicators in Iowa must be licensed by the Iowa Department of Agriculture and Land Stewardship (IDALS). Reputable Dow City providers will follow Iowa's regulations on pesticide use, especially regarding perimeter treatments and protecting well water, which is common in our area. Always verify a company's state license and ask about their practices for safeguarding children, pets, and local waterways.

4What should I look for when choosing a pest control company serving Dow City?

Prioritize companies with strong local experience, as they understand regional pest patterns. Verify their Iowa commercial applicator license, ask for local references, and ensure they carry proper insurance. Look for providers who offer integrated pest management (IPM) strategies, which focus on prevention and targeted treatments, and be wary of those who pressure you into unnecessary long-term contracts upfront.

5Is DIY pest control effective, or should I always call a professional in our region?

For minor, isolated issues (like a single wasp nest), DIY can be sufficient. However, for recurring infestations, structural pests like termites or carpenter ants, or rodents, professional help is recommended. Professionals have access to more effective materials and the expertise to find entry points, which is crucial given Iowa's temperature extremes that drive pests indoors. Misapplied DIY chemicals can also pose risks to your family and local environment.
